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ender

Forumthread: Summe ohne doppelte Werte

Summe ohne doppelte Werte
07.04.2009 13:54:26
Daniel
Hallo zusammen,
ich benötige eine Formel, mit der ich über einen Zellbereich eine Summe ziehen kann. Dabei sollen mehrfach vorkommende Werte nur einmal gezählt werden. Eine erste Version der Formel habe ich bereits:
=SUMME(WENN(HÄUFIGKEIT(A1:A12;A1:A12)>0;A1:A12))
Mein Problem: in der Liste können auch Leerzellen auftreten oder Zellen mit einem "x". In solchen Fällen funktioniert meine Formel nicht mehr. Habt ihr hier eine makro- und hilfsspaltenfreie Lösung für mich?
Besten Dank schon mal und viele Grüße
Daniel
Anzeige

8
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Summe ohne doppelte Werte
07.04.2009 14:33:48
Gilligan
Ist der Zellbereich variabel oder immer gleich groß?
wenn die Doppler hintereinander kommen
07.04.2009 14:42:07
WF
Hi Daniel,
... ist es einfach - folgende Arrayformel:
=SUMME(WENN(A1:A19A2:A20;A1:A19))
ARRAY-Formel {=geschweifte Klammern} nicht eingeben;
Abschluß der Formel mit gleichzeitig Strg / Shift / Enter (statt Enter allein); - das erzeugt sie.
Durcheinander wirds komplizierter.
Salut WF
Anzeige
AW: wenn die Doppler hintereinander kommen
07.04.2009 14:46:14
Daniel
Hallo WF,
kommen sie leider nicht. Sie können irgendwo in der Liste stehen. Also z. B.:
1
2
x
2
3
5
x
1
AW: Summe ohne doppelte Werte
07.04.2009 14:42:53
Daniel
Hallo Gilligan,
der Zellbereich ist grundsätzlich erstmal fix. In seltenen Fällen muss er ggf. mal erweitert werden - dann denke ich im Zweifel aber dran, den Bezug in der Formel anzupassen. ;-)
Anzeige
AW: Summe ohne doppelte Werte
07.04.2009 14:52:32
D.Saster
Hallo,
Matrixformel:
{=SUMME((ZÄHLENWENN(INDIREKT("A$1:A"&ZEILE(1:12));A1:A12)=1)*(WENN(ISTZAHL(A1:A12);A1:A12;0)))}
Gruß
Dierk
AW: Summe ohne doppelte Werte
07.04.2009 14:57:46
Daniel
Super!!! Genau das ist es - tausend Dank, Dierk!!! :-D
Ich weiß noch nicht genau wie die Formel funktioniert, aber da werde ich gleich mal drüber nachgrübeln!
Danke euch allen für die Hilfe - das Forum hier ist klasse! :)
Viele Grüße
Daniel
Anzeige
ohne Multiplikation kannst Du ISTZAHL sparen
07.04.2009 15:23:18
WF
Hi Ihr 2,
{=SUMME(WENN(ZÄHLENWENN(INDIREKT("A1:A"&ZEILE(1:20));A1:A20)=1;A1:A20))}
Salut WF
AW: ohne Multiplikation kannst Du ISTZAHL sparen
07.04.2009 15:28:11
Daniel
Funktioniert tadellos und ist noch kürzer als die Variante von Dierk.
Danke dir!! :-)
;

Forumthreads zu verwandten Themen

Anzeige
Anzeige
Anzeige
Anzeige
Anzeige

Infobox / Tutorial

Summe ohne doppelte Werte in Excel berechnen


Schritt-für-Schritt-Anleitung

Um in Excel eine Summe zu berechnen, ohne dass doppelte Werte in den Zellen gezählt werden, kannst du folgende Array-Formel verwenden. Diese Formel summiert nur die einzigartigen Werte und ignoriert Leerzellen oder nicht-numerische Werte.

  1. Wähle die Zelle aus, in der du die Summe anzeigen möchtest.

  2. Gib die folgende Formel ein (ohne die geschweiften Klammern):

    =SUMME(WENN(ZÄHLENWENN(A1:A12; A1:A12)=1; A1:A12))
  3. Drücke Strg + Shift + Enter, um die Formel als Array-Formel zu bestätigen. Excel zeigt dann die geschweiften Klammern {} automatisch an.

Diese Methode ist effektiv, um die Excel Summe ohne doppelte Werte zu berechnen.


Häufige Fehler und Lösungen

  • Problem: Die Formel gibt einen Fehler zurück oder zeigt eine falsche Summe.

    • Lösung: Stelle sicher, dass du die Formel mit Strg + Shift + Enter eingibst. Wenn du nur die Eingabetaste drückst, wird die Formel nicht korrekt ausgeführt.
  • Problem: Die Formel ignoriert die Leerzellen nicht.

    • Lösung: Überprüfe, ob die Zellen tatsächlich leer sind oder ob sie unsichtbare Zeichen (z.B. Leerzeichen) enthalten.

Alternative Methoden

Neben der oben genannten Methode gibt es auch andere Ansätze, um doppelte Werte in Excel nur einmal zu summieren:

  1. PivotTable: Du kannst eine PivotTable verwenden, um die eindeutigen Werte zu summieren. Ziehe das Feld in den Wertebereich und wähle "Summe" als Zusammenfassungsfunktion.

  2. SUMMEWENNS-Funktion: Eine weitere Möglichkeit ist die Verwendung der SUMMEWENNS-Funktion in Kombination mit einer Hilfsspalte, die die doppelten Werte identifiziert.

    =SUMMEWENNS(A1:A20; A1:A20; "<>""x""")

Diese Methoden sind nützlich, wenn du komplexere Bedingungen hast oder

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ige